Understanding the Foundations of Commercial Buildings

Commercial foundations differ from residential ones in depth, load distribution, and exposure to environmental stresses. They often support heavy equipment, multiple floors, and large parking decks, making any settlement or cracking a critical issue. Early detection of movement, moisture ingress, and soil instability is essential to prevent costly downtime and safety hazards.

Common Causes of Foundation Problems in Commercial Structures

Key factors include:

  • Soil settlement or shrinkage after excavation
  • Water infiltration from inadequate drainage or leaching
  • Adjacent construction or excavation that alters load paths
  • Seismic activity or ground vibrations
  • Age‑related material degradation, especially in concrete and steel reinforcement

Assessment Techniques Before Repair

Professional evaluation combines visual inspection, ground‑penetrating radar, borehole testing, and load‑testing of existing footings. Accurate data guide the selection of the most effective repair method.

Primary Repair Methods and Their Trade‑offs

MethodIdeal Use CaseProsCons
Underpinning (mass concrete)Deep settlement, large load shiftsPermanent, high load capacityDisruption, high cost
Underpinning (steel jack piles)Quick load transfer, minimal excavationFast, adaptableLimited to moderate loads
Slab jack systemFloat slab over voidsNon‑invasive, cost‑effectiveRequires ongoing monitoring
Hydrostatic pressure (pumping)Void filling, moisture controlEffective for small voidsLimited depth reach

Choosing the Right Solution: Decision Factors

Consider the following:

  • Load magnitude and distribution
  • Depth and extent of settlement
  • Site accessibility and surrounding infrastructure
  • Project timeline and budget constraints
  • Regulatory and zoning requirements

Implementation Steps for a Commercial Repair Project

  • Obtain permits and coordinate with local authorities.
  • Set up temporary support systems if needed.
  • Excavate to access footings or slab edges.
  • Install chosen repair system (jacks, piles, concrete).
  • Apply waterproofing membranes and drainage controls.
  • Re‑compact and backfill with graded material.
  • Conduct post‑repair monitoring and load testing.
  • Preventive Measures to Extend Foundation Life

    Regular maintenance can mitigate future issues:

    • Ensure proper grading and drainage around building perimeter.
    • Install perimeter waterproofing and vapor barriers.
    • Monitor soil moisture levels during heavy rains.
    • Schedule periodic inspections for early detection of movement.

    Conclusion: Building Confidence in Structural Stability

    Commercial foundation repair is a complex but manageable process when guided by accurate assessment and a method tailored to the building's specific needs. By selecting the appropriate technique and integrating preventive strategies, owners can protect their investment, maintain operational continuity, and ensure safety for occupants and equipment.
